Transaction 37ca273839837817146dc47b90dcc84ffcc270d69eedfbb01d9e12b513e3f759
2 Input
2 Outputs
- 37ca273839837817146dc47b90dcc84ffcc270d69eedfbb01d9e12b513e3f759:0
- 37ca273839837817146dc47b90dcc84ffcc270d69eedfbb01d9e12b513e3f759:1
value 55745721
address 1DtyEHeN7tNLq4sWd8ifygQYptVa69FdRc
value 475177
address 1HcLfCMf7FryyZpwXfPsuMGCn3y2m2qQPu